Jagmandir

Jagmandir is a historic island palace located on Lake Pichola in Udaipur, India. Built in the 17th century, it served as a luxurious retreat and royal residence for Mughal rulers and Indian royalty. Surrounded by water, it features stunning architecture, gardens, courtyards, and pavilions, offering picturesque views of the lake and city. Today, Jagmandir functions as a heritage hotel and tourist attraction, providing visitors with a glimpse into royal Mughal architecture and history. Its peaceful setting and beautiful design make it a popular destination for travelers seeking both cultural insight and scenic beauty.
